List of Inks & Stamps used
Inks: All Palette Hybrid Ink pads Giverny Green, Reflection Blue, Pure Poppy & Noir Black
Stamps: Tac Hello Baby & Melanie Muenchinger Just so Hippy animal series by Gina K Designs
I heat set & then to be on the safe side I put them in the dryer for 10 minutes.

I meant to order a window heart tin when I placed my order with PTI & I forgot so I used a copper tin that I bought at Michael's & rolled the onesies to look like roses & added flowers in between.
